We present a process-calculus model for expressing and analyzing service-based systems. Our approach addresses central features of the service-oriented computational model such as distribution, process delegation, communication and context sensitiveness, and loose coupling. Distinguishing aspects of our model are the notion of conversation context, the adoption of a context sensitive, message-passing-based communication, and of a simple yet expressive mechanism for handling exceptional behavior. We instantiate our model by extending a fragment of the π-calculus, illustrate its expressiveness by means of many examples, and study its basic behavioral theory; in particular, we establish that bisimilarity is a congruence. © 2008 Springer-Verlag Berlin Heidelberg.
